What is prayer?

  • It's communicating with God and spiritualizing thought.
  • Prayer and belief in God are a foundation upon which we rely in times of trouble and when we need comfort.
  • Many use prayer as their tool of choice for guidance and solving problems, resulting in healing.

The Lord's Prayer

MATTHEW 6:6-13

 


In introducing the Lord's Prayer given to us by Jesus Christ, the Bible says, "When thou prayest, enter into thy closet, and when thou hast shut thy door, pray to thy Father which is in secret; and thy Father which seeth in secret shall reward thee openly. 

Mary Baker Eddy, the founder of Christian Science, gives us a spiritual sense of the Lord's Prayer on page 16 of Science and Health

Our Father which art in heaven,
Our Father-Mother God, all-harmonious,

Hallowed be Thy name.
Adorable One.

Thy kingdom come.
Thy kingdom is come; Thou art ever-present.

Thy will be done in earth, as it is in heaven.
Enable us to know, — as in heaven, so on earth, — God is omnipotent, supreme. 

Give us this day our daily bread;
Give us grace for to-day; feed the famished affections;

And forgive us our debts, as we forgive our debtors.
And Love is reflected in love;

And lead us not into temptation, but deliver us from evil; 
And God leadeth us not into temptation, but delivereth us from sin, disease, and death. 

For Thine is the kingdom, and the power, and the glory, forever. 
For God is infinite, all-power, all Life, Truth, Love, over all, and All. 
 

"In order to pray aright, we must enter into the closet and shut the door. We must close the lips and silence the material senses. In the quiet sanctuary of earnest longings, we must deny sin and plead God's allness. We must resolve to take up the cross, and go forth with honest hearts to work and watch for wisdom, Truth, and Love. We must 'pray without ceasing.' Such prayer is answered, in so far as we put our desires into practice. The Master's injunction is, that we pray in secret and let our lives attest our sincerity." (Science & Health 15:14)

With God, all things are possible

The first chapter of Science and Health is entitled Prayer. The first line states, "The prayer that reforms the sinner and heals the sick is an absolute faith that all things are possible to God, — a spiritual understanding of Him, an unselfed love." 

Understanding God is the key to healing prayer, because if we understand Him we will understand our spiritual nature as His reflection. God is good, and as children of God we all reflect good. This is one of the foundational teachings of Christian Science.
